一种基于OpenFlow协议的虚拟网络流量分类方法技术

技术编号:9720404 阅读:158 留言:0更新日期:2014-02-27 07:43
本发明专利技术公开了一种基于OpenFlow协议的虚拟网络流量分类方法,网络虚拟化平台在转发数据包时,对于从虚拟网络边缘向虚拟网络内部转发的数据包,添加流标签;对于从虚拟网络内部端口向虚拟网络边缘端口转发的数据包,弹出流标签。

【技术实现步骤摘要】
—种基于OpenF1w协议的虚拟网络流量分类方法
本专利技术属于计算机网络
,具体涉及一种基于OpenFlow协议的网络虚拟化平台虚拟网络流量分类的方法。
技术介绍
随着互联网技术的飞速发展,互联网应用与用户数量急剧增长,基于TCP/IP的互联网逐渐暴露出许多的问题与弊端。不少国家提出了下一代互联网计划,软件定义网络应运而生。OpenFlow软件定义网络由两部分组成:数据平面,用来转发网络数据包;控制平面,用来控制网络数据包的转发策略。数据平面的OpenFlow交换机内部维护一张转发表,称之为虚拟网络流规则描述表。虚拟网络流规则描述表可以根据数据包包头的一层(物理层)到四层(传输层)特征进行匹配,并指定匹配虚拟网络流规则描述表项的数据包的处理方法。当一个数据包进入OpenFlow交换机后,OpenFlow交换机会查询内部的虚拟网络流规则描述表,按虚拟网络流规则描述表处理数据包。若OpenFlow交换机内部没有能够匹配数据包的虚拟网络流规则描述表,OpenFlow交换机会将这个数据包转发给控制平面的OpenFlow控制器,OpenFlow控制器再向OpenFlow交换本文档来自技高网...

【技术保护点】
一种基于OpenFlow协议的虚拟网络流量分类方法,其特征在于:网络虚拟化平台在转发数据包时,修改控制器到物理交换机的下行信令,使得转发后的数据包具有特定虚拟网络流标签。

【技术特征摘要】
1.一种基于OpenFlow协议的虚拟网络流量分类方法,其特征在于: 网络虚拟化平台在转发数据包时,修改控制器到物理交换机的下行信令,使得转发后的数据包具有特定虚拟网络流标签。2.根据权利要求1所述的方法,其特征在于: 虚拟网络内部端口收发的数据包应包含虚拟网络的流标签; 所述虚拟网络交换机内部端口为虚拟网络拓扑中连接链路的端口。3.根据权利要求1-2任一所述的方法,其特征在于: 虚拟网络边缘端口收发的数据包不包含虚拟网络的流标签,不包含虚拟网络流标签的数据包不属于任何虚网; 虚拟网络交换机边缘端口为虚拟网络拓扑中不连接链路的端口。4.根据权利要求1-3任一所述的方法,其特征在于: 当数据包来自于虚拟网络交换机抑制端口时,对数据包的转发操作无效; 虚拟网络交换机抑制端口为虚拟网络拓扑中被关闭的端口。5.根据权利要求3-4任一所述的方法,其特征在于: 虚拟网络拓扑建立好后,为虚拟网络添加虚...

【专利技术属性】
技术研发人员:魏亮张健男刘韵洁刘江黄韬丁健俞淑妍
申请(专利权)人:北京邮电大学
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1